Jacksonville Jaguars RB Maurice Jones Drew
Fresh off receiving a new contract ( four-years, $31 Million contract includes $17.5 million guaranteed) and veteran Fred Taylor leaving for the Patriots this offseason, MJD is primed for a huge season.ย The versatile Jones-Drew has scored 40 TDs in his first three seasonsโsecond in the NFL only to LaDainian Tomlinsonโs ย 61 during that spanโand he led all NFL backs with 62 catches in 2008.

Carolina Panthers RB DeAngelo Williams
This former thought to be โbustโ emerged as one of the NFLโs most dominating backs in 2008โrushed for 1,515 yards with a 5.5 ypr average and 18 touchdowns.ย Williams became the Panthers lead back in their two-headed backfield, starting ahead of 2008 rookie Jonathan Stewart.ย In 2009, look for Williams to have another huge year since Stewart is banged up heading into the season with an Achilles injury.

Indianapolis Colts QB Peyton Manning
No Fantasy Football list would be complete without the NFLโs top quarterback over the last decade.ย Manning won his third MVP award in 2008 and extended his NFL record in โ08 with his ninth 4,000-yard season (passing numbers of 371-555, 66.8%, 4002 yards, 27 TDs, and 12 INTs.ย With his knee totally healthy and a receiving corps featuring Wayne, Gonzalez, Clark and emerging rookie Austin Collie, Manning doesnโt look to slowdown in 2009.

Arizona Cardinals WR Larry Fitzgerald
The most dominating receiver in the NFL has to have a spot in the Top 10, despite several FF analysts saying to wait on selecting a receiver.ย Fitzgerald was sensational in โ08 putting up regular season numbers of 96 receptions for 1431 yards and 12 TDs.ย He also led the Cardinals to their first Super Bowl while establishing playoff records of 30 receptions for 546 yards and 7 TDs including 2 TDs in their Super bowl loss.ย Fitz is a terror around the endzone and every Cardinalsโ opponent needs to know where he is at all times despite two other 1,000-yard receivers on his team (Breaston and Boldin).

Chicago Bears RB Matt Forte
One of the NFLโs most versatile running backs, who should only improve with the addition of Pro Bowl quarterback Jay Cutler.ย As a rookie in 2008, Forte carried the Bearsโ offense with numbers 316 rushes for 1238 yards and 8 TDs plus a team-high 63 receptions for 477 yards and 4 TDs.ย Bears offense should definitely improve on their 2008 numbers as Cutler will be working to form a rapport ย with Forte, dynamic TE Greg Olsen, former college teammate Earl Bennett and speedster WR Devin Hester.

St. Louis Rams RB Steven Jackson
A dominating dual-threat running back who really is his teamโs only option at times.ย Jackson had his fourth consecutive 1,000-yard rushing season despite missing five games because of injuries finishing with numbers 253 rushes for 1,042 yards, 4.1 ypr, and 7 TDs; 40 receptions for 379 yards, 9.5 ypc, and 1TD.ย Look for Rams new staff led by offensive coordinator Pat Shurmur to get the ball to Jackson often.

New Orleans Saints QB Drew Brees
The NFLโs passer leader in terms of yardage in 2008 has a โbombs awayโ mentality.ย Brees working with a multitude of backs, receivers, and tight ends became the NFLโs second quarterback to throw for over 5,000 passing yards in a season, finishing with 5,069 (Dan Marinoโs is mark of ย 5,084 is the record).ย Look for the 2008 NFL Offensive Player of the Year to continue putting up big fantasy numbers in head coach Sean Paytonโs offense as he has a lot of weapons in RB Pierre Thomas, RB/Slot WR Reggie Bush, WR Marques Colston and others to work with.

Houston Texans WR Andre Johnson
The NFLโs greatest secret may reside in Houston, TX and his name is โAndre Johnsonโ.ย Coming off an injury plagued season in โ07 people didnโt expect much from the former Hurricanesโ star in โ08.ย But to a lot of fantasy football playerโs surprise, Johnson led the NFL in catches and yardage as he put up Pro Bowl numbers (115 receptions, 1575 yards, ย 13.7 ypc, and 8TDs with a long of 65 yards.ย If potential breakout quarterback Matt Schaub can stay healthy the skyโs the limit for this big fast receiver.

New England Patriots QB Tom Brady
I know Tom โTerrificโ only played in one series of one game in 2008 as a knee injury (ACL) ravaged his season.ย However there is no way that I am leaving arguably the best quarterback in the game off my list.ย Brady is coming back to an offense that put up 410 points and 43 TDs with former deep benchwarmer Matt Cassel at the helm, so the former Super Bowl MVP should pick right back up leading Bill Belichickโs attack.ย And letโs not forget that Brady threw an NFL record 50 TDs in 2007 while throwing to still on the team targets WR Randy Moss and WR Wes Welker.
